                  Originally posted by Monty Fisto
                  Big reach advantage for Fulton is going to be a major obstacle for Inoue to get around. This is no gimme for either fighter.
                  That's just 3.5 inches, which really translates to under 2 in terms of range. Most fighters will face bigger reach differentials in sparring on a daily basis. Fulton's reach is about the same as Jason Moloney, although there's a huge skill and athleticism gap between those two as well. The biggest factor in this match is what we don't know: how Inoue will be able to perform at this weight.
